Independent auditor reports clean KMAG opinion, recommends stronger journal-entry documentation

Hiawatha School Board · December 9, 2024

Lehi/Barney & Associates lead auditor Jessica Linsley told the Hiawatha School Board the district’s 06/30/24 financial statements received a clean opinion on the Kansas Municipal Audit and Accounting Guide (KMAG) basis, with no audit adjustments or findings; the audit includes a recommendation to retain supporting documentation for journal entries.

Jessica Linsley, lead auditor with Lehi/Barney & Associates, told the Hiawatha School Board that the district’s financial statements for the year ending June 30, 2024, received a clean opinion on the district’s KMAG (Kansas Municipal Audit and Accounting Guide) basis and that auditors found no audit adjustments, findings, material weaknesses or significant deficiencies. “It was a clean opinion,” Linsley said during the presentation.
